Transaction 2473d9615972cf24561eada28ce29cbb940e09b51c9c842e4005af2ca6c8e8dd

4 Input
2 Outputs
  • 2473d9615972cf24561eada28ce29cbb940e09b51c9c842e4005af2ca6c8e8dd:0
  • value  990650
    address  1KEKzzVsUF42MM483RNqyshHRsjehwtNvt
  • 2473d9615972cf24561eada28ce29cbb940e09b51c9c842e4005af2ca6c8e8dd:1
  • value  27321254
    address  1MeLs9VvK97LyvCzbA8mHBJJ3FndGHRhsy